Function


symbol description
hs1bp3 Predicted to enable phosphatidylinositol binding activity. Acts upstream of or within negative regulation of autophagy. Human ortholog(s) of this gene implicated in essential tremor 2. Orthologous to human HS1BP3 (HCLS1 binding protein 3).
